Output 297425f31f481e2b86af6148d560c823a28798676142c680508e21d6b36ffc87:1

value
40632
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 586e5927b044f3bafdf1dd52110c1a45c0659d09 OP_EQUALVERIFY OP_CHECKSIG
address
194af1jocn8mXPKN2UciShWb8yMM6qCyKQ
transaction
297425f31f481e2b86af6148d560c823a28798676142c680508e21d6b36ffc87
spent
true